Flow Reviews

The 10 Best Free Wrike Alternatives To Use in 2020 (Free & Trial)
The last spot in this roundup of free Wrike alternatives goes to Flow. Flow is a rather simplistic alternative solution to Wrike. If you feel Wrike’s features are overwhelming and too complicated for your team, Flow is the right tool to go for!
The Top 9 Wrike Alternatives For Project Management in 2019 (Free & Paid!)
Flow advertises itself as simple task management, and it’s exactly that. Tasks are arranged in an easy-to-follow way, letting users quickly update where they are. Their reporting on task and project progress is also a plus. It lets you know how far along a task is until it’s completed, and how each team member is contributing to it.
